Day, Another CO2-Is-A-Climate-Driver Inconsistency \u2014 NoTricksZone<\/a><\/cite><\/blockquote>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>The observed climate sensitivity (CS) to a perturbation to Earth\u2019s Energy Imbalance (EEI) is, in a new study (Pauling et al., 2023), defined as -0.4\u00b0C per -9 W\/m\u00b2, or 0.044\u00b0C per W\/m\u00b2. These values were assessed using observations from Mt.
